Transaction f98c51eb877eba73a5dad28248e64261a3223148e9c81901e194762163f77eea
1 Input
2 Outputs
- f98c51eb877eba73a5dad28248e64261a3223148e9c81901e194762163f77eea:0
- f98c51eb877eba73a5dad28248e64261a3223148e9c81901e194762163f77eea:1
value 273891
address 3KFvxY95xzUw7zxLE7uAiz7giRoTaBWGnt
value 316313
address 17NXVAhKbQqBsJwcFtJHDsQWz5k3EP2CkH